Recently was sent 2 parcels from the USA.

One was sent using USPS first class international small package mail. This one departed a transfer airport in LHR and the next day was updated, passed through customs etc, and delivered a few days later by RM

2nd parcel was sent USPS international Priority mail. This one supposedly departed a transfer airport in LHR on the 14th, which is an automatic update after the plane which package was meant to be on arrives. No update since. Pointless contacting Parcelforce as they just say they haven't received it, and USPS will say its left the country & contact parcelforce. Parcel force deliver the USPS Priority mail.

Seems that when you use USPS Priority mail, which can cost double that of the first class international option, it will be passed to PARCELFORCE to deliver, not RM, and looking at other forums it seems after departing plane at LHR, it can be a week or 2 before it progresses any further. its as if Parcelforce are holding items a while before processing. Surely if we send priority which costs a lot more, it should be processed quicker?

this seems to be a regular occurence when sending priority. Any i have sent by first class international postage that always gets passed to RM, they get marked as departing transfer airport at LHR, and a day later, or 2 max, it in in the hands of RM.

Anyone else had this issue where Parcelforce take weeks processing items, as if they hold it and delay initial scan to make their processing times seen faster

They aren’t holding it as you say, that is a criminal offence. Between USPS and PFW it has to pass through UK customs, who can take several weeks to process mail at the moment if items are selected for extra checks. See all the threads on this forum where people have had the same issue, mainly with items that use RM at this end.
